Sergeant Reckless, U.S. Marine
Served during the Korean War,
Earned her stripes going 'twixt and 'tween
The front line and the ammo store,
Getting ammo, then going back
To fellow Marines to reload
And hold their line in the attack.
Best in a Marine, Reckless showed.
After the cease fire, Reckless went
Back to U.S. Camp Pendleton,
Where the rest of her life was spent
With Marines and Fearless, her son.
For Sergeant Reckless, Semper Fi
From this true war horse does apply.
